The Surprising Origins Of Plastic Surgery: Which Country Pioneered It?

what country invented plastic surgery

The origins of plastic surgery can be traced back to ancient civilizations, but it was in India during the 6th century BCE that the first documented evidence of reconstructive surgical procedures emerged. The Sushruta Samhita, an ancient Sanskrit text attributed to the physician Sushruta, describes techniques for repairing noses, ears, and other body parts using skin grafts, a practice known as rhinoplasty. This pioneering work laid the foundation for modern plastic surgery, making India a strong contender for the title of the country that invented the field. While advancements continued in various cultures over the centuries, India's early contributions remain a cornerstone in the history of plastic surgery.

Ancient India's Contributions: Sushruta Samhita, early rhinoplasty techniques using skin grafts

The origins of plastic surgery trace back to ancient India, where the *Sushruta Samhita*, a seminal text compiled around 600 BCE, laid the foundation for surgical techniques still relevant today. Sushruta, often hailed as the "Father of Plastic Surgery," detailed procedures with precision and foresight, particularly in rhinoplasty. His methods were not merely corrective but also restorative, aiming to rebuild both form and function. Among his innovations, the use of skin grafts from the cheek to reconstruct nasal defects stands out as a testament to his ingenuity. This technique, described in the *Sushruta Samhita*, involved meticulous steps: preparing the graft, ensuring proper blood supply, and suturing it into place. The procedure’s success relied on understanding anatomy and post-operative care, principles that Sushruta emphasized centuries before modern medicine.

To perform early rhinoplasty as Sushruta described, one would begin by assessing the patient’s overall health, as the procedure was invasive and required resilience. The surgeon would then excise a strip of skin from the cheek, ensuring it remained attached at one end to maintain blood flow. This pedicle graft was rotated and sutured over the nasal framework, often carved from the patient’s own cartilage. Sushruta recommended using wine (likely for its antiseptic properties) to clean the area and honey to aid healing. Bandages were applied, and the patient was advised to avoid strenuous activity for weeks. Notably, Sushruta’s approach included psychological care, as he understood the social stigma of disfigurement. His holistic view of medicine—treating the body and mind—set a standard for surgical practice.

Comparing Sushruta’s techniques to modern rhinoplasty reveals striking parallels. Today’s surgeons use local or free flaps, often harvested from the forehead or ear, echoing Sushruta’s pedicle graft. While contemporary methods employ advanced tools like microscopes and synthetic materials, the core principle remains: restoring nasal structure and function. Sushruta’s emphasis on precision and patient care predates the sterile techniques and anesthesia of modern surgery, yet his work demonstrates an understanding of tissue viability and wound healing that is scientifically sound. His contributions were not isolated; they were part of a broader medical tradition in ancient India that valued observation, experimentation, and documentation.

The *Sushruta Samhita*’s influence extends beyond rhinoplasty, offering insights into wound management, fracture treatment, and even cosmetic enhancements. For instance, Sushruta described repairing earlobe deformities caused by heavy ornaments, a common issue in ancient India. His text also includes instructions for removing foreign objects from wounds and treating animal bites, showcasing his versatility as a surgeon. Renaissance Europe: Gaspare Tagliacozzi's advancements in nasal reconstruction using arm flaps

The origins of plastic surgery trace back to ancient civilizations, but a pivotal figure in its development was Gaspare Tagliacozzi, a Renaissance surgeon from Italy. His groundbreaking work in nasal reconstruction using arm flaps marked a significant leap in surgical technique and anatomical understanding. By the 16th century, Tagliacozzi had refined a method that not only restored function but also prioritized aesthetic outcomes, setting a precedent for modern plastic surgery.

Tagliacozzi’s technique, detailed in his 1597 treatise *De Curtorum Chirurgia per Insitionem* ("On the Surgery of Mutilation by Grafting"), involved transferring skin from the upper arm to the nose in a pedicle flap. This flap remained attached to the arm for several weeks, ensuring a blood supply until the graft had healed sufficiently to survive on its own. The procedure was meticulously planned, with precise measurements and careful consideration of the patient’s anatomy. Tagliacozzi’s approach was revolutionary for its time, combining surgical skill with an artistic eye to achieve natural-looking results.

One of the most striking aspects of Tagliacozzi’s work was his emphasis on patient selection and postoperative care. He recommended the procedure primarily for young, healthy individuals, as their bodies were better equipped to heal. Patients were advised to remain still for extended periods, often with their arm strapped across their face, to ensure the flap’s success. This level of dedication from both surgeon and patient underscores the complexity and commitment required for such early reconstructive surgeries.

Comparing Tagliacozzi’s methods to modern techniques highlights both the ingenuity of his work and the advancements that followed. Today, nasal reconstruction often employs local flaps or free tissue transfer, with microsurgery enabling precise reconnection of blood vessels. However, the principles of tissue viability and aesthetic integration that Tagliacozzi championed remain foundational. His contributions not only advanced surgical practice but also challenged societal perceptions of disfigurement, offering hope and restoration to those affected.

Modern Pioneers: Sir Harold Gillies' World War I facial injury repairs

The horrors of World War I left an indelible mark on humanity, but amidst the devastation emerged a beacon of hope in the form of Sir Harold Gillies, a pioneer in the field of plastic surgery. As a young surgeon serving in the British Army, Gillies witnessed firsthand the devastating facial injuries inflicted by modern warfare. Shrapnel, bullets, and chemical weapons left soldiers disfigured, both physically and psychologically. It was this grim reality that spurred Gillies to develop innovative techniques to repair these complex wounds, laying the foundation for modern plastic surgery.

Gillies' work was not merely about restoring physical appearance; it was about rebuilding lives. He understood that facial disfigurement could have profound effects on a soldier's mental health and social reintegration. His approach was holistic, combining surgical skill with empathy and a deep understanding of the human condition. Gillies established a specialized ward at the Cambridge Military Hospital in Aldershot, where he and his team treated over 11,000 soldiers during the war. Here, he pioneered the "tubed pedicle" technique, a groundbreaking method that involved transferring skin from one part of the body to the face, using a tube of tissue to maintain blood supply. This technique allowed for the reconstruction of noses, ears, and other facial features with unprecedented success.

To appreciate Gillies' impact, consider the case of a soldier who had lost his nose to a gunshot wound. Gillies meticulously crafted a new nose using skin from the patient's forehead, a process that required multiple stages and immense precision. The result was not just a functional nose but one that closely resembled the patient's original features. This attention to detail and commitment to patient-centered care set Gillies apart. His work was not just about survival; it was about restoring dignity and hope.

Gillies' legacy extends far beyond the battlefields of World War I. His techniques and principles continue to influence plastic surgery today, shaping how surgeons approach facial reconstruction and aesthetic procedures. For instance, the tubed pedicle technique has evolved into more sophisticated methods like free tissue transfer, where microsurgery allows for the precise relocation of tissue with its own blood supply. Modern plastic surgeons owe much to Gillies' pioneering spirit and his unwavering dedication to improving patients' lives.
